If this sounds like you, and the career below sounds exciting, we'd like to hear from you.Manulife LEAD(Leadership, Experience, Advocacy, and Development) is a program will enable you to discover individual career aspirations and various fields of expertise. You will gain an insight into, and understanding of, the world's leading Financial Services Institution and according to your strengths and development objectives, you will be assigned to challenging projects, corporate-wide initiatives and hands-on development opportunities in order to unleash your potential. What motivates you?Manulife LEAD:Provides a multi-faceted learning and development experience for entry level talent to advance into future leadership roles aligned to our corporate vision, mission, strategic priorities and brand valuesDevelop skills for individuals that aspire towards a career in order to assume further responsibilities at ManulifeEstablishing a powerful internal network to advance their careers within the organizationOn the job you will:LEAD is an 18-month graduate program where Management Associates complete the following:Business Rotations – you will have the opportunity to gain experience in business units and specialist functions. It's your chance to find the team you fit into best and begin your Manulife career.Development – undertake an exclusive series of classroom learning and experiential programs sponsored by Manulife senior executives to help you develop core business skillsMentors and Buddies – Benefit from being assigned a Mentor (typically a senior leader) to help you with your career and personal development and well as business buddies to help you navigate our global organizationWe are looking for someone with: Bachelor/Master's degree holderOpen to candidates with less than 2 years of work experienceEnglish is the business language of Manulife, you need to be able to speak business-level EnglishWe're looking for well-rounded, digitally minded, and customer-focused, who have previously engaged in social work and extra-curricular activitiesBe eligible to work permanently in Hong Kong, Malaysia, Philippines, Singapore and JapanOur commitment to youOur mission; to be a part of making Decisions Easier and Lives BetterA leadership team dedicated to your growth and successA bold ambition and set of goals to be a leader in driving transformation in our industryOur best. What are you waiting for?Connect with our team!Forquestions and inquiriesabout the LEAD graduate program, please email About Manulife and John HancockManulife Financial Corporation is a leading international financial services group that helps people make their decisions easier and lives better. With our global headquarters in Toronto, Canada, we operate as Manulife across our offices in Asia, Canada, and Europe, and primarily as John Hancock in the United States. We provide financial advice, insurance, and wealth and asset management solutions for individuals, groups and institutions. At the end of 2022, we had more than 40,000 employees, over 116,000 agents, and thousands of distribution partners, serving over 34 million customers. At the end of 2022, we had $1.3 trillion (US$1.0 trillion) in assets under management and administration, including total invested assets of $0.4 trillion (US $0.3 trillion), and segregated funds net assets of $0.3 trillion (US$0.3 trillion). We trade as 'MFC' on the Toronto, New York, and the Philippine stock exchanges, and under '945' in Hong Kong.Manulife is an Equal Opportunity Employer
